U.S. Pharmacist

From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ia

August 2005 issue

The U.S. Pharmacist ISSN 0147-7633[1] is a monthly magazine for pharmacists and health professionals.[2] It is published by Jobson Publishing.[3] In 2018 the company was acquired by WebMD.[3] The magazine is based in Riverton, New Jersey.[4] As of 2013 Harold Cohen was the editor-in-chief of U.S. Pharmacist.[5]
